We would like you to illustrate the comparison of two production methods of producing cooking oils:
- One method is complex, heavily processed and made with chemicals;
- The second method is simple, chemical-free and more natural. This method is our production technique.

Attached we have sketched the stages of production for these two methods. We need you, as an illustrator, to re-create this as a high quality infographic, compatible for mobile phone viewing (for example on Instagram stories).

Colours: for the "processed" production method, use greys or dull colours to highlight the unnatural process. For our production method, use our attached colour palette, yellow (for the oil) or natural colours (e.g. sky blue, green). Don't use any unnatural looking colours, for example the pipes that go to fill up the bottles shouldn't be blue or green, they should be the colour of the oils, which are provided with the oil bottle images.

Please note, the key messages from this sketch/infographic are:
1) The processed oil production method is complex, industrial, full of chemicals, unnatural and unhealthy.
2) Our production method is simpler, natural and healthier.

      Some feedback:
      - Bottles wrong order, you put our Filtered bottle in the First Pressed part and vice versa
      - Overuse of colours, for example, the canola seeds aren’t multi-coloured, nor is the oil that flows into the bottles multi-coloured
      - Didn’t use source location provided for the natural production method. I provided the google maps location.
      - Didn’t use bottle images provided/attached for processed oils.
      - The Bleach and Hexane bottles/canisters in the processed oil section are too small and the Bleach is not even a bottle/canister
      - The refined with hexane part looks like it blends into the naturally made production method
      - Overall the graphics look like cheap computer graphics rather than professional-looking drawn art
      - Bottles were not placed at the top with the title, as noted in Project Scope sketch
      - Colours for the processed oil part aren’t grey or dull colours, as requested
